RULING

As the court was preparing to write the judgment in this matter and upon perusing the file, the court notes that the issue coming up for determination is a distribution of the estate. As such, for the court to be able to distribute to the parties in terms of Section 40 of the Law of Succession Act, it is proper that the parties present a true, accurate and actual position of the estate.

In particular, the court notes that some properties of the estate have been disposed of and the titles transferred to third parties. These particular assets have not been disclosed. Some of the properties have equally been sub divided and allocated new numbers.

It is also clear that some of the dependants have settled in some of the parcels of land which fact has not been disclosed to the court.

As such, the parties herein are directed to file comprehensive affidavits detailing the assets of the estate, the beneficiaries and the status of occupation of each of the parcels of the estate.

The matter shall be mentioned on 25/1/2022 at 2. 30 pm for further orders of the court.
